Cartogiraffe.com

Loch a' Sheangearraidh

Loch a' Sheangearraidh in Na h-Eileanan Siar, Beàrnaraigh Mòr.

Pin to show location on the map Loch a' Sheangearraidh

Vegetation and ground cover
water